Sichuan, known for its stunning landscapes and rich culture, offers travelers a unique blend of natural beauty and culinary delights. From the majestic mountains to the vibrant cities, this region is a feast for the senses, especially for those who appreciate spicy food and traditional arts.

Sightseeing

Giant Panda Breeding Research Base: a great spot for panda lovers, visit early in the morning for feeding times.
Jiuzhaigou Valley: known for its turquoise lakes and waterfalls, check for seasonal closures as it can be affected by weather.
Leshan Giant Buddha: the world's largest stone Buddha statue, consider visiting during weekdays to avoid crowds.
Mount Emei: a sacred Buddhist mountain with scenic trails, bring sturdy shoes for the hike.
Chengdu Research Base of Giant Panda Breeding: another opportunity to see pandas, tickets can sell out quickly during peak seasons.
Wuhou Shrine: a historical site dedicated to the Three Kingdoms, nearby Jinli Ancient Street offers local snacks.
Dujiangyan Irrigation System: an ancient engineering marvel, it's best to visit in spring when the surrounding area is lush.
Qingcheng Mountain: a Taoist mountain with beautiful landscapes, the cable car can save time if you're short on it.

Local food and drinks

Mapo Tofu: spicy tofu dish with a rich flavor
Kung Pao Chicken: a classic stir-fry with peanuts
Hot Pot: a communal dining experience with spicy broth
Dan Dan Noodles: flavorful noodles with a spicy sauce
Sichuan Pepper: a unique spice that numbs the mouth

Local traditions

Sichuan Opera: famous for its face-changing performances
Tibetan New Year: celebrated in Tibetan communities
Dragon Boat Festival: featuring dragon boat races and zongzi
Chengdu International Beer Festival: a lively celebration of craft beer

About Sichuan

The province is home to the famous Giant Pandas, ancient temples, and breathtaking scenery like the Jiuzhaigou Valley. However, be prepared for the hustle and bustle of urban life in Chengdu, where the pace can be overwhelming for some visitors.

Sichuan has a rich history that dates back thousands of years, serving as a cradle of ancient Chinese civilization. The region was known for its agricultural innovations and trade routes, particularly during the Han and Tang dynasties.

In more recent history, Sichuan has faced challenges such as natural disasters and political upheaval. Despite these struggles, it has remained a cultural hub, preserving its traditions while embracing modernity, making it a fascinating destination for travelers.
